





















Arc'teryx, a Vancouver-based company, has cultivated a sterling reputation over three decades for its exceptional alpine clothing. Initially a specialist in gear for climbing, hiking, and demanding mountain expeditions, the brand has more recently expanded its influence into mainstream fashion, elevating its performance-driven outerwear beyond niche appeal to become a widely sought-after item.
Understanding Arc'teryx's extensive range of jackets can be complex, as they are categorized using a system of Greek letters and additional modifiers. These designations indicate specific intended uses, from lightweight designs for fast-paced activities to robust options for severe conditions. The brand's jackets are broadly divided into shell jackets, which prioritize protection against elements like wind and rain, and insulated jackets, designed to provide warmth. Shells come in hard and soft varieties, with hardshells offering maximum weatherproofing and softshells providing enhanced breathability and flexibility. Insulated jackets utilize various fills, including down and synthetic options like Coreloft, which excels in wet environments. Arc'teryx also frequently integrates Gore-Tex technology, offering different versions like standard Gore-Tex for balanced protection, Gore-Tex Pro for extreme durability and breathability, and Gore-Tex Infinium for lighter, comfort-focused water resistance.
